Branding is more than just a logo or a slogan; it encompasses the overall experience and perception that guests have of a hotel. A strong hotel brand should reflect the unique identity and values of the property, creating a lasting impression on guests. From the design elements to the customer service interactions, every touchpoint should align with the brand promise. marketing is essential for hotels to reach their target audience and drive bookings. Digital marketing, social media, email campaigns, and partnerships with online travel agencies are just some of the tactics hotels use to promote their properties. A well-rounded marketing strategy should be tailored to the specific needs and preferences of the hotel's target market. Calculating the return on investment (ROI) of branding and marketing activities is crucial for hotels to assess their effectiveness and make informed decisions. KPIs such as revenue per available room (RevPAR), average daily rate (ADR), and occupancy rate can provide insights into the financial performance of the hotel. By tracking these metrics over time, hotels can identify trends and opportunities for improvement. In addition to financial KPIs, hotels can also measure the success of their branding and marketing efforts through guest satisfaction scores, brand awareness surveys, and online reviews. Positive feedback and high ratings can indicate that the hotel's branding and marketing strategies are resonating with guests and driving loyalty. Overall, branding and marketing are integral components of a hotel's success. By investing in a strong brand identity, implementing targeted marketing campaigns, and analyzing key performance indicators, hotels can enhance their reputation, attract more guests, and ultimately drive revenue growth.
